    BarBaxisburn appears to be associated with the on-line drinking game Barbax.
    It is a piece of spyware. although at this time there appears to be no removeal tool.

    Use RegEdit to search the Registry - record the location then delete all references to the
    spyware. Delete the file from the HD.

    As is the case with Keyloggers, this could be difficult to find and delete.

    You can disable it in MSCONFIG

    Also check Task Manager Processes tab to make sure its not running.
